CUSTOMS BROKER CONTINUING P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T (CPD) 
ONLY 6 DAYS TO GO - DUE DATE 31 MARCH 2025

 
A reminder to check you have completed your CPD & CBC training requirements for the customs broker licensing period ending 31 March 2025. A maximum of 12 points in Stream B only counts towards your total of 30 CPD points.

Last week Sal Milici, General Manager Trade Policy & Operations - FTA | APSA met up with Daniel HoangAllen Hoang and James Hoang from Core Logistics a valued Freight & Trade Alliance (FTA) member and a Melbourne-based transport company specialising in container moving services, shipping container storage, and reliable logistics solutions.

They spoke on the impact of rising port charges, the evolving regulatory landscape, and the opportunities and challenges of the West Gate Tunnel Project—particularly the significant additional costs that will be cascaded down to importers and exporters.

PART X Competition & Consumer Act

The Australian Peak Shippers Association (APSA) is the designated peak shipper body granted status by the Federal Minister for Infrastructure and Transport under Part X of the Consumer & Competition Act to represent the interests of Australian shippers generally in relation to liner cargo shipping services. The following notice has been received and is available to members' reference.

Planned ICS Outage

On Sunday the 06 April 2025, the Department's ICT service provider is implementing an essential yearly update due to the change over from Australian Daylight Savings Time to Australian Eastern Standard Time. The outage window will be from 01:00AM (AEST) to 05:00AM (AEST) on Sunday the 06 APRIL 2025.
